FP Markets and IC Markets are both prominent Australian brokers, offering comprehensive trading options across forex, CFDs, stocks, indices, commodities, and cryptocurrencies. The key difference lies in their minimum deposit requirements, with FP Markets offering a lower entry point of $100 compared to IC Markets' $200, appealing to traders with smaller capital. FP Markets is favoured by traders seeking low entry costs and access to TradingView, while IC Markets attracts those prioritising ultra-low spreads and fast execution speeds. Both are regulated by ASIC and CySEC, ensuring a secure trading environment.
